Image Representation and Description

In the realm of image processing, the art of representation holds paramount significance. How do we convert intricate visual data into meaningful descriptions using advanced techniques such as boundary, regional, texture, color, and shape descriptors? Through a journey into the world of image representation, we unravel the key to unlocking the essence of visual content.

As we delve into the nuances of image representation techniques like SIFT and SURF, a spectrum of possibilities emerges for object recognition and beyond. What secrets lie within the realm of image portrayal, and how do these techniques shape the future landscape of visual understanding and interpretation? Join us in exploring the evolution of image representation and its transformative impact on the digital realm.

Understanding Image Representation and Description

Image representation and description play a vital role in the field of image processing. When it comes to analyzing and understanding images, various descriptors are utilized to capture different aspects. These descriptors include boundary descriptors, regional descriptors, texture descriptors, color descriptors, and shape descriptors. Each descriptor provides unique information about the image, aiding in its representation and analysis.

In addition to traditional descriptors, advanced techniques like Scale-Invariant Feature Transform (SIFT) and Speeded Up Robust Features (SURF) have revolutionized image representation. These techniques enable the extraction of key points from an image, making it robust to changes in scale, rotation, and illumination. Such advancements enhance the accuracy and efficiency of image processing tasks by providing more detailed and invariant representations.

Image representation is crucial not only for image processing but also for object recognition tasks. By accurately representing images, machines can identify and classify objects with high precision. This has significant applications in fields like computer vision, robotics, and artificial intelligence, where accurate image representation is essential for understanding the visual world around us.

As technology continues to evolve, the future of image representation and description holds promising advancements. From improved feature extraction methods to more efficient algorithms, researchers are constantly pushing the boundaries of what is possible in image analysis. Understanding the fundamentals of image representation is the cornerstone for future developments in this exciting and rapidly growing field.

Boundary Descriptors

Boundary Descriptors are crucial in image processing techniques, employed to define the boundaries of objects within an image. These descriptors focus on capturing the edge characteristics, such as sharp transitions in pixel intensity, aiding in object recognition and feature extraction processes.

By utilizing techniques like the Canny edge detector or the Sobel operator, Boundary Descriptors outline the contours and shapes of objects in an image, providing valuable information for analysis and classification tasks. These descriptors play a significant role in distinguishing objects based on their structural features, contributing to the overall understanding of image representation.

In the realm of computer vision, Boundary Descriptors help in segmenting objects from their background by highlighting the regions where significant changes in pixel values occur. This detailed delineation of object boundaries enhances the accuracy of image recognition systems, enabling efficient processing and interpretation of visual data.

Regional Descriptors

Regional Descriptors in image representation focus on capturing specific characteristics within distinct regions of an image. These descriptors analyze and extract features such as edges, corners, and textures within localized areas, providing valuable information for image processing techniques. By segmenting the image into regions, regional descriptors enhance the understanding of intricate patterns and details essential for accurate representation and interpretation.

One common method of regional descriptors is the Histogram of Oriented Gradients (HOG), which computes the distribution of gradient orientations within localized regions. This technique is particularly effective in object detection tasks, where the spatial arrangement of gradients in different image regions helps in identifying objects based on their shapes and structures. Regional descriptors play a crucial role in enhancing the discriminative power of image analysis algorithms by focusing on specific areas of interest, leading to more precise and robust image representations.

Regional descriptors offer a granular approach to feature extraction by zooming into unique regions of an image, enabling a more nuanced understanding of its contents. These descriptors contribute significantly to tasks such as image classification, object recognition, and image retrieval by capturing detailed information at a localized level. Incorporating regional descriptors into image processing workflows enhances the overall effectiveness and accuracy of diverse applications, showcasing the fundamental importance of localized feature representation in image analysis techniques.

Texture Descriptors

Texture Descriptors in image representation focus on capturing the visual patterns within an image to characterize its surface attributes. By analyzing the variations in intensity and colors at a finer level, texture descriptors provide valuable information for image processing techniques. They play a crucial role in enhancing the representation of intricate details in images.

These descriptors enable the differentiation between smooth and rough surfaces, identifying patterns like wood grain, fabric texture, or metal finishes. Through statistical analysis, texture descriptors quantify the spatial arrangement of pixel intensities to define unique textural features. This enhances the understanding of image content beyond color and shape, aiding in accurate image classification and recognition tasks.

Texture descriptors incorporate methods such as Local Binary Patterns (LBP) and Gray Level Co-occurrence Matrix (GLCM) to extract texture information from images. By capturing the relationships between neighboring pixels, these descriptors offer insights into variations in texture complexity, directionality, and uniformity. Integrating texture descriptors with other image representation techniques enriches the analysis of visual content for applications like object recognition and image retrieval.

Color Descriptors

Color Descriptors are crucial in image representation, capturing the various hues and tones present in an image. By analyzing the distribution and intensity of colors, these descriptors enable the classification and recognition of objects based on their chromatic properties. Different color spaces such as RGB, CMYK, and HSV play a significant role in defining color features for image processing techniques.

In image processing, color descriptors provide valuable information about the visual content of an image, aiding in tasks such as image retrieval, segmentation, and object recognition. For example, in a scene containing multiple objects of different colors, color descriptors help in distinguishing and categorizing these objects based on their color characteristics. They contribute to enhancing the accuracy and efficiency of image analysis algorithms.

By incorporating color descriptors alongside other feature descriptors like texture, shape, and size, a comprehensive representation of the visual content can be achieved. This holistic approach allows for a more robust and detailed analysis of images, enabling applications such as content-based image retrieval, automated image tagging, and object tracking to be performed with greater precision and reliability.

Shape Descriptors

Shape Descriptors in image processing play a vital role in capturing and quantifying the geometric properties of objects within an image. By analyzing the shape of objects, these descriptors provide valuable information for various applications such as object recognition and classification. Examples of shape descriptors include Hu moments, Fourier descriptors, and Zernike moments.

Hu moments are invariant to translation, rotation, and scale, making them robust for shape representation in image analysis. Fourier descriptors capture the boundary shape characteristics of objects by decomposing the contour into its frequency components. Zernike moments are effective for shape representation in circular objects, utilizing orthogonal polynomials to describe shape features accurately.

These shape descriptors aid in distinguishing and categorizing objects based on their unique geometric properties. By extracting and analyzing the shape information within an image, these descriptors enhance the understanding and interpretation of visual data, contributing to advancements in image representation techniques and object recognition algorithms.

Incorporating shape descriptors into image processing workflows improves the efficiency and accuracy of tasks such as shape matching, object tracking, and pattern recognition. The utilization of shape descriptors enables computers to interpret and analyze visual content more effectively, leading to enhanced image representation and description in various domains.

Scale-Invariant Feature Transform (SIFT)

Scale-Invariant Feature Transform (SIFT) is a powerful image processing technique used for extracting distinctive features from images, enabling robust matching between different views of an object or scene. SIFT operates by detecting key points in an image and describing them based on their local appearance, such as gradients, textures, and histograms.

Key aspects of the SIFT algorithm include:

  • Detection of key points: SIFT identifies significant points in an image that are invariant to changes in scale, rotation, and illumination.
  • Feature description: It generates descriptors for each key point by considering the gradient orientations around the key point, creating a unique representation.
  • Matching: By comparing the feature descriptors of key points between different images, SIFT facilitates reliable image recognition and matching tasks.

SIFT has proven effective in various applications, including object recognition, image stitching, and image retrieval, due to its robustness to changes in viewing conditions. Its scale invariance and distinctive feature extraction capabilities make it a cornerstone in the field of image representation and description.

Speeded Up Robust Features (SURF)

Speeded Up Robust Features (SURF) is a widely used image processing technique in the field of computer vision. It is known for its efficiency in detecting and describing interest points in an image. SURF operates by identifying key points based on their unique characteristics, such as corners and edges, which are essential for image recognition tasks.

This technique is particularly valuable in scenarios where traditional methods like SIFT may be computationally expensive. SURF achieves its speed and robustness through the use of integral images and box filters, allowing for rapid feature extraction while maintaining accuracy. By utilizing these methods, SURF enhances the speed and reliability of image processing tasks.

With its capability to handle various image scales and rotations effectively, SURF has become a preferred choice for applications like object recognition and image stitching. Its adaptability to different scenarios and robustness to noise make it a versatile tool in modern image representation techniques. As technology advances, the significance of SURF in the realm of image analysis and understanding is expected to grow exponentially.

Image Representation in Object Recognition

In object recognition, image representation plays a fundamental role in identifying and distinguishing objects within an image. By extracting key features such as shapes, textures, and colors, the representation process enables computers to interpret visual data and make informed decisions based on the extracted features. Techniques like SIFT and SURF enhance the accuracy and robustness of object recognition systems, allowing for precise matching of objects across different images.

Furthermore, image representation in object recognition involves transforming raw image data into a structured format that can be easily analyzed by machine learning algorithms. This transformation process simplifies the complexity of visual data, enabling efficient comparison and matching of objects in images. Effective image representation is crucial for the accurate detection and classification of objects, forming the foundation of advanced computer vision applications.

By leveraging sophisticated image processing techniques, such as boundary descriptors and regional descriptors, object recognition systems can effectively differentiate between objects based on their unique visual characteristics. These techniques enable the identification of objects in varying contexts and orientations, improving the overall performance and reliability of object recognition algorithms. Overall, image representation in object recognition is a fundamental aspect of computer vision that continues to drive advancements in the field of artificial intelligence and image analysis.

The Future of Image Representation and Description

The future of image representation and description is heading towards more advanced techniques that incorporate deep learning and artificial intelligence algorithms. With the rapid developments in technology, we can expect to see improvements in image processing techniques that enhance accuracy and efficiency in recognizing complex patterns within images.

These advancements will lead to more sophisticated algorithms that can handle large-scale datasets and provide more nuanced representations of images. This could revolutionize fields such as object recognition, where the ability to accurately identify and categorize objects within images is crucial.

Additionally, the future of image representation may involve the integration of multimodal data sources, combining information from different modalities such as text, audio, and video to create a more comprehensive understanding of visual content. This holistic approach to image representation could open up new possibilities for applications in areas such as image captioning, visual question answering, and content-based image retrieval.

Overall, the future holds exciting prospects for image representation and description, with innovations that push the boundaries of what is currently possible. As technology continues to evolve, we can anticipate even more sophisticated and efficient methods for representing and interpreting images, paving the way for new opportunities and capabilities in various domains.

In conclusion, mastering various image representation techniques is essential in modern image processing. From boundary to texture descriptors, each method plays a crucial role in capturing the essence of visual data. As technology advances, the future holds exciting developments in object recognition and beyond.

Continuous innovation in scale-invariant feature transform (SIFT) and speeded up robust features (SURF) opens new possibilities for robust image analysis. Understanding these advancements will shape the future landscape of image representation and description, paving the way for more sophisticated applications in diverse fields.